New Eight Megapixel EOS Digital Rebel XT SLR Adds Resolution, Speed and Creative Control to the Imaging Infantry
'As we have with the Digital Rebel's 35mm film-based cousins, we are expanding the line-up of Digital Rebel SLRs, offering consumers a wider variety of features and price points based on their needs and budgets,' said Yukiaki Hashimoto, senior vice president and general manager of the consumer imaging group at Canon U.S.A., Inc, a subsidiary of Canon Inc. (NYSE:CAJ). 'Even though we have increased the resolution, speed, responsiveness and energy efficiency on the new EOS Digital Rebel XT camera, we have decreased its size and weight, making it more comfortable to hold and use. Indeed, it is nearly three ounces lighter and more than a half-inch smaller than the original EOS Digital Rebel model.' "

Most people with normal size hands think the Rebel XT grip is too small. Especially with heavy lenses attached. If canon is concerned about ergonomics, they should make two models - one for normal to large hands, and one for small hands at the same price.
OR, if Canon was really smart, they would design the grip so you could screw on an outer grip cover. This would allow people to easily customize the grip size.
